What international policies of Gorbachev's ended thee cold war?
1) renewing detente with the west, summits were held, Reagan and Gorbachev got on well and agreed to commit to change
2) 1986: declaration the USSR had no further intentions to spread communist ideology
3) agreements to reduce nuclear arms and withdraw troops from Afghanistan.
What home policies helped Gorbachev end the cold war?
1) Perestroika: an attempt to save crumbling soviet economy by modernization, western style polices were introduced, allowing people to create businesses
2) Glasnost: freedom of speech for press and people, political prisoners were freed and Brezhnev doctrine ended so troops withdrew from Eastern Europe
What are thee steps to ending the cold war?
1) Poland declares independence in 1989
2) Hungary follows suit in September
3) Berlin wall falls and Germany is reunified
4) communist governments in Romania, Czechoslovakia and Bulgaria fall
5) Warsaw pact ends in 1991
6) Bush and Gorbachev declare end of the cold war
